山海华夏体育网

👨‍💻 LeetCode刷题- C++ - 简单-罗马数字转整数 📜

更新时间:2025-03-07 20:21:56

导读 大家好!今天我们将一起学习如何用C++来解决一个有趣的题目——罗马数字转整数。罗马数字是一种古老的计数方式,对于现代编程来说,将其转

大家好!今天我们将一起学习如何用C++来解决一个有趣的题目——罗马数字转整数。罗马数字是一种古老的计数方式,对于现代编程来说,将其转换为阿拉伯数字是一个很好的练习机会。让我们一起来看看这个过程吧!

首先,我们需要了解一些基本的罗马数字规则:

- I = 1

- V = 5

- X = 10

- L = 50

- C = 100

- D = 500

- M = 1000

接下来,我们来考虑一些特殊情况。例如,当较小的数字出现在较大的数字之前时,我们应该进行减法运算。比如 IV = 4 (V - I),IX = 9 (X - I)。

现在,让我们动手编写代码。我们可以创建一个函数,遍历给定的罗马字符串,然后根据上述规则进行计算。这将帮助我们理解字符串处理和条件判断的重要性。

通过这个练习,你不仅可以提高自己的编程技巧,还能更好地理解和使用C++语言的各种特性。希望这个简单的示例能激发你对算法的兴趣,继续加油哦!💪

LeetCode CPlusPlus 编程练习

免责声明:本文由用户上传,如有侵权请联系删除!